English term or phrase: thousands
Includes Rs. 494,456 thousands (Previous year Rs. 35,205 thousands ) on account of provision for Net realisable value. Excluding goods in transit

Tausend
Explanation:
Es handelt sich um 35.205 Tausend Pakistanische Rupien.

1.00 EUR = 126.885 PKR

http://www.xe.com/de/currencyconverter/convert/?Amount=1&Fro...

In manchen Texten werden die Zahlen als Tausenderbeträge angegeben.
Es sind also 35.205.000 PKR bzw. 35,205 Mio. PKR.

Reference: Rs - pakistani rupee

Reference information:
As standard in Pakistani English, large values of rupees are counted in terms of thousands, lakh (100 thousand) and crore (10 million).
